OverviewFrom Experience to Creativity is the first book to address the significant relationship between the fields of experiential education and creativity that has been overlooked for far too long. Cape provides an academic presentation of creativity through fun and inspiring examples in easily accessible language that helps readers move past the layperson's understanding of creativity. More than just an artistic pursuit or only available to a select few, creativity is a universal human trait that can be intentionally developed and taught. Simply learning about creativity and applying the concepts presented can make readers more creative and adaptable to a quickly-changing world.From Experience to Creativity explains the various levels of creativity, place creativity into the context of the field of experiential education, provides simple methods of incorporating creativity into the lives of readers and participants, offers structured processes of promoting and using creativity, and finally, it contains a case study of Kurt Hahn that explores his creative nature.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ationDaniel Cape has worked in the field of experiential education for over fifteen years in US and international camp settings, classrooms, project based learning, and independence transition programs, in addition to his experience serving as a Combat Engineer officer in the Army National Guard. He has an MS in Experiential Education from Minnesota State University, Mankato and is working on his Ph.D. in Psychology with a specialization in Creativity Studies from Saybrook University. Daniel has been a caricature artist for nearly fourteen years and recently started his non-profit, EPIC Smiles (www.epicsmiles.org), which aims to build a global community of caricatures for youth through art instruction and providing new and creative experiences for young people.
